Internet Explorer
Use Microsoft Internet Explorer to view web sites. To do this, create the
connection first via an ISP or network (“Remote Access (Modems)” on
page 86), then you can also download files and programs from the Internet
To switch to Internet Explorer on your CK60, double-tap the Internet
Explorer icon on your desktop.

Browsing the Internet
1 Set up a connection to your ISP or corporate network using information
as described in “Remote Access (Modems)” on page 86.
2 To connect and start browsing, do one of the following:
•Tap Favorites from the toolbar, and then tap the favorite to view.
•In the Address bar that appears at the top of the screen, enter the web
address you want to visit using the input panel, then tap the [Enter]
key on the panel to go to that web site.
